List up to two … WebAuthor-date method of in-text citation. Use author's last name and the year of publication, E.g., (Jones, 1998), and a complete reference should appear in the reference list at the end of the paper. WebSep 26, 2024 · Scholarly Article Accessed Online. APA style does not distinguish between articles accessed through a database and articles accessed via the Web. The exact citation formation will depend on whether the article has a DOI (Digital Object Identifier) available. If the article information DOES include a DOI, place it at the end of the citation. WebAn APA citation generator is a software tool that will automatically format academic citations in the American Psychological Association (APA) style. It will usually request vital details about a source -- like the authors, title, and publish date -- and will output these details with the correct punctuation and layout required by the official APA style guide.

(2011). albert ullaWebOct 20, 2024 · When quoting directly from a work, include the author, publication year, and page number of the reference (preceded by “p.”). Method 1: Introduce the quotation with a signal phrase that includes the author’s last name; the publication year will follow in parentheses.
